A comprehensive bibliography of the French capital. Includes sections on geography, guidebooks, history, economy, literature and intellectual life, politics, the arts, architecture and urban planning, and mass media. The history, arts, and literature sections take up the bulk of the text. Most cited works were published after 1970. Annotation copyrighted by Book News, Inc., Portland, OR

In "Out and About London," Thomas Burke artfully captures the essence of early 20th-century London through a series of vivid sketches and narratives that intertwine personal anecdotes with atmospheric detail. His distinctive literary style combines lush, impressionistic prose with keen observations, creating a tapestry that reflects the vibrancy and complexity of urban life. Set against a backdrop of a bustling metropolis filled with diverse characters and locales, Burke's work resonates with the Modernist movement, echoing the sentiments of contemporaries who sought to illuminate the multifaceted nature of city existence. Thomas Burke, a prominent British writer and social commentator, drew on his own experiences as a Londoner to craft this compelling collection. His early life in the working-class districts of East London profoundly influenced his perceptions and literary expressions. Burke's deep familiarity with the city and its inhabitants allowed him to weave stories that illuminate the overlooked and marginalized voices of urban society, making his work a significant contribution to the portrayal of London's cultural landscape during a pivotal era.
